Description

2-Methyl-3-Cyanomethyl-6-Methoxy Pyridine is a versatile pyridine derivative characterized by its methoxy and cyanomethyl substituents, serving as a critical building block in advanced organic synthesis. Its molecular structure makes it a valuable precursor for the development of complex heterocyclic compounds and active pharmaceutical ingredients (APIs). This intermediate is primarily sought by research institutions and manufacturers in the pharmaceutical and agrochemical industries for the synthesis of novel compounds.

Basic Information

Product Name 2-Methyl-3-Cyanomethyl-6-Methoxy Pyridine
CAS No. 32383-10-1
Molecular Formula C9H10N2O
Molecular Weight 162.19 g/mol
Synonyms 6-Methoxy-2-methylnicotinonitrile; 3-Cyanomethyl-6-methoxy-2-methylpyridine; 2-Methyl-6-methoxy-3-pyridineacetonitrile; 6-Methoxy-2-methyl-3-pyridineacetonitrile; 2-Methyl-3-(cyanomethyl)-6-methoxypyridine; 6-Methoxy-2-methylpyridine-3-acetonitrile

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at controlled room temperature (15-25°C). Keep away from strong acids and incompatible materials such as strong oxidizing agents. The product is stable under recommended conditions.
